Rally driving light
 
I noticed the other day one of my rally lights not working. I saw a piece of metal stuck between the outside metal cover and the glass. I think that piece of metal is probably a spring that holds the light tight.
So my question where do I get another light and is it dissembled by undoing the screw at the bottom?

Here is the light 63120137303

There is a little spring clip i believe that presses against the ring to hold the reflector in place. I would undo the bottom screw and see whats going on. And see if that bulb is burned out.

If I just need the bulb is there a number for it? I am wondering if local parts store would stock it?

ECSTuning 11-28-2017 08:29 AM

Yep,

Right in this link with aftermarket options: 63217160779 OEM or 63170412647 or the Ziza H3 bulbs

Any suggestions on how to undo the screw on the bottom? I don't want to strip the screw, but I have put in a lot of muscle and it just is not budging.

bcgreen 12-02-2017 11:15 AM

Okay, after alot of banging with screw driver, hammer and chemicals I was able to take it apart. The sealed bulb looks fine so I can't really tell if it's bad, but I am going to say it is since I made contact with a deer. He bent the base down and I had to straighten it out.
Reading the bulb it says on the back: 03102002
The lens reads as: JUTE 9614 HR (E 13) 10

Those are the bulbs linked above just pop out that sealed beam front and pop the bulb out the back. Otherwise if its beat up from the dear you might have to get a whole unit.
